Output ecb46fe30643a0f91560368b4263c961977f4f90468123b53e83c2fc7a051a02:4

value
1000000000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 66b243a7143b969791f8e1fca9cb28cc8d5a9c45 OP_EQUALVERIFY OP_CHECKSIG
address
DEW71qtFFyarybvdyXq1szmHUpZgWxeomE
transaction
ecb46fe30643a0f91560368b4263c961977f4f90468123b53e83c2fc7a051a02